summaryrefslogtreecommitdiffstats
path: root/src/multimedia
diff options
context:
space:
mode:
authorPiotr Srebrny <piotr.srebrny@qt.io>2021-05-19 15:55:00 +0200
committerLars Knoll <lars.knoll@qt.io>2021-05-20 06:08:59 +0000
commit4262e48197d66e5ec215ba30b3dd2e4469694609 (patch)
treede3d85add13cc76eb67a543d9ae0e4e94df60c3e /src/multimedia
parent9f360934cb90b667ac9119ee93f67980b7b4e563 (diff)
Correct maxlen computation
Change-Id: I643d4d2933eee41beab49d8d8134897ccf6f0dd7 Reviewed-by: Lars Knoll <lars.knoll@qt.io>
Diffstat (limited to 'src/multimedia')
-rw-r--r--src/multimedia/audio/qwavedecoder.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/multimedia/audio/qwavedecoder.cpp b/src/multimedia/audio/qwavedecoder.cpp
index 89f654bd1..8b90a0803 100644
--- a/src/multimedia/audio/qwavedecoder.cpp
+++ b/src/multimedia/audio/qwavedecoder.cpp
@@ -182,7 +182,7 @@ qint64 QWaveDecoder::readData(char *data, qint64 maxlen)
return 0;
qint64 nSamples = maxlen / format.bytesPerSample();
- maxlen = nSamples * format.bytesPerFrame();
+ maxlen = nSamples * format.bytesPerSample();
device->read(data, maxlen);
if (!byteSwap || format.bytesPerFrame() == 1)